NOTICE OF CHANGE OF LOCATION
OF SPECIAL MEETING OF SHAREHOLDERS
TO BE HELD ON MARCH 27, 2020

 

To the Shareholders of Southwest Georgia Financial Corporation:

 

Due to the rapidly evolving public health concerns relating to the coronavirus, or COVID-19, and out of an abundance of caution to support the health and well-being of our employees and shareholders, N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that the location of the Special Meeting of Shareholders (the “Special Meeting”) of Southwest Georgia Financial Corporation (the “Company”) has been changed. As previously announced, the Special Meeting will be held on Friday, March 27, 2020 at 10:00 a.m. Eastern Time. In light of public health concerns, the Special Meeting will be held in a virtual meeting format only, via live webcast/teleconference. You will not be able to attend the Special Meeting in person.

 

As described in the proxy statement/prospectus for the Special Meeting previously distributed, you are entitled to participate in and vote at the Special Meeting if you were a shareholder of record as of the close of business on February 12, 2020, which is the record date for the Special Meeting, or hold an appropriate legal proxy for the meeting provided by your broker, bank or other nominee. You will be able to attend and participate in the Special Meeting at http://www.viewproxy.com/SouthwestGeorgiaFinancial/2020SM/. You may vote during the Special Meeting by following the instructions available on the Special Meeting website.

 

Whether or not you plan to attend the Special Meeting by virtual means, we urge you to vote and submit their proxy in advance of the Special Meeting by one of the methods described in the proxy statement/prospectus. The proxy card included with the proxy statement/prospectus previously distributed will not be updated to reflect the information provided above and may continue to be used to vote your shares in connection with the Special Meeting. If you have previously submitted a proxy using one of the methods described in the proxy statement/prospectus and proxy card, you vote will be counted and you do not need to submit a new proxy or vote at the Special Meeting, although you may change or revoke your vote by attending the Special Meeting and voting virtually or by one of the other methods described in the proxy statement/prospectus.
